Three murder investigations have been launched following a weekend of violence in Greater Manchester. Three men died in Timperley, Bury and Levenshulme over the weekend as emergency services attended a number of serious incidents across the borough.

And as the murder probes continue, police are also investigating a shooting in Wigan that saw gunshots blasted at a house and a spate of 'violent incidents' across Brinnington that saw groups of men wielding weapons and cars damaged. Emergency services were first called out in the early hours of Saturday (July 8) to Silver Street in Bury.

Police and paramedics raced to the scene at around 4.25am, where a man was found injured outside a bar. The 35-year-old victim, now named as much-loved dad Piotr Ludwiczak, was rushed to hospital with life-threatening injuries as police cordoned off the road and an evidence tent was erected.

However the following day, Sunday (July 9), it was confirmed Piotr had died in hospital. Police said enquiries suggested Piotr had been 'punched' before then falling to the ground.
